Ms. Pinky,

You will agree that I have been unfailingly courteous & patient so far.
However, I'm afraid, I must come to the conclusion that Nokia does
not respond to polite interlocutions. I bought the new 7370 handset at
your suggestion, since HCL was unable to repair the previous 8250
handset, despite carrying out 3 repairs, during the warranty period.
You might recollect that I had articulated my apprehension even then
that any other handset I bought would entail my suffering the same
treatment as earlier, at Nokia's hands.

Though you did attempt to address my problem with the 8250 handset,
true to my concern, even the new 7370 handset you arranged for me
turned out to be defective within two days of purchase. Again, at your
request, I took the set to HCL, who confirmed the defect to Anupama
from your office. Anupama then assured me that she would get back to
you & arrange for the defective set to be replaced. This was last
Tuesday & I have not heard from you or your office since then, without
my having to pursue the matter. As I said once earlier, it has become a
part of my daily routine now that I need to call you every morning to
push Nokia to fulfil its legal & moral obligation. I have been doing
this now for over thee months & I am exasperated at Nokia's callous
disregard for consumers' suffering. It seems that Nokia expects me to
sit back & wait for the company to deign its benevolence upon me. I am
now at the end of my tether. Kindly arrange to replace the defective 7
370 handset at the e
arliest.

I had hoped that this issue could be sorted out amicably. However, if
Nokia wishes to escalate the issue, I am now more than prepared to do
so. I do not like resorting to uncivil behaviour, but you leave me with
no alternative.

I await a response from your end.
